Del 26 de octubre al 8 de noviembre de 2020
¡Es hora de otra actualización! Mira lo que ha estado haciendo el equipo de desarrollo durante las últimas semanas.
Avance de desarrollo reciente por parte del equipo core CKB:
-
Ampliación de
ckb-indexer
con más opciones de filtro. -
Discutir los requisitos de transacciones pool y trabajar en el nuevo estimador de tarifas.
-
Panel de control interno rediseñado para mostrar métricas de rendimiento.
-
Diseño de ‘traits’ (Rust) de forma arriba hacia abajo.
-
Experimentación con la ejecución de protocolos CKB en navegadores web a través de Tentacle WASM.
-
Diseño de la especificación de la red de canales.
Ampliación de ckb-indexer
El ckb-indexer permite consultar datos desde nodos para aplicaciones y análisis.
Quake ha estado trabajando en el ckb-indexer
basándose en los requisitos de este hilo de conversación. Consideró varias soluciones y todavía está optimizando las compensaciones.
Estimador de tarifas
La estimación precisa de las tarifas es importante para las aplicaciones y los protocolos de Capa 2.
Boyu sigue trabajando en la calculadora de tarifas. Ha implementado un prototipo y ha estado evaluando diferentes modelos. También discutió los requisitos de pool para respaldar el estimador de tarifas con Dingwei.
Panel de métricas
Las métricas actuales se pueden encontrar en el explorador de CKB.
Tenemos pruebas comparativas de sincronización en cadena y TPS, pero no hemos almacenado los resultados para su análisis. Guozhen y Yulong han estado trabajando en el panel de métricas, que facilitará la presentación, el análisis y la comparación de las métricas.
Diseño de ‘traits’ (Rust)
En Rust, trait
es una colección de métodos definidos para un tipo desconocido: Self
. Pueden acceder a otros métodos declarados en el mismo trait.
Dingwei comenzó a rediseñar los traits en el código fuente de CKB. Solíamos diseñar traits que proporcionaban todas las funcionalidades que podían proporcionar los módulos. Esta estrategia ascendente conduce a módulos altamente acoplados.
Dingwei planeó diseñar los rasgos de arriba hacia abajo. Él analizará lo que necesitan los módulos de la capa superior e implementará una interfaz suficiente utilizando los módulos.
Protocolos de CKB en los navegadores web
Los clientes ligeros permiten interacciones de blockchain sin confianza sin requerir la sobrecarga de ejecutar un nodo completo y abrir nuevos tipos de aplicaciones.
Quake lidera un equipo que trabaja en la demostración del cliente ligero. Han estado trabajando en la ejecución de protocolos CKB en navegadores web a través de Tentacle WASM porque la demostración se ejecutará en el navegador.
Red de canales
Las redes de canales pueden maximizar el rendimiento y minimizar la latencia del procesamiento de las transacciones, mejorar la privacidad e incluso pueden proporcionar cierta interoperabilidad entre blockchains.
El equipo de la red de canales ha estado trabajando para proponer la especificación general del canal de pago.
Consulta esta publicación en Nervos Talk.
Otros proyectos
-
Actualización de la interfaz de usuario de Neuron para la migración de ACP.
-
Investigación de las funciones criptográficas del pasaporte electrónico.
-
Función para la transferencia de la célula ACP en Bitpie sdk.
-
Lanzamiento de ckb-sdk-java v0.37.0.
Para mantenerse actualizado sobre todo lo relacionado con Nervos:
Únete a nuestra comunidad: Telegram - Discord - GitHub - Foro - Twitter
Esta es una traducción al español por @luisantoniocrag y revisada por @Lalo